š„ Brunchinā & Brews: Two Denver Festivals You Donāt Wanna Miss
This Saturday, Denverās serving up a double dose of delicious. Whether your vibe is bottomless mimosas or bluegrass with a side of craft beer, youāve got options.
![]() If brunch is your love language, this is your Super Bowl. BrunchFest has earned its spot as the go-to foodie event in Denver, and for good reasonāitās a bottomless celebration of everything that makes brunch great. Weāre talking endless mimosas with Korbel California champagne, zesty Real Dill Bloody Marys, plus mocktails and bubbly from Gruvi for those taking it easy. The best part? Denverās hottest brunch spots will all be serving up bites, so you can taste your way through the scene without waiting for a single table. Add live entertainment, a buzzing foodie crowd, and sunshine on Tivoli Quad, and youāve got the kind of afternoon that makes Monday jealous. If you love brunch, you owe it to yourself to go. | ![]() When brunch winds down, keep the party rolling just a few blocks away at TheBigWonderful Beer Fest. This isnāt just a beer festāitās a full-on celebration of Colorado craft culture. Youāll get unlimited pours of 16+ breweries, ciders, and seltzers, all in your very own souvenir tasting cup. But itās not only about the drinks. The fest brings in live bluegrass all day, local artisan vendors to browse, food options, and even misting stations so you can cool off between tastings. With early and late sessions, you can make it a pre-dinner hang or go all night. Either way, itās the kind of event that reminds you why Denver is one of the best beer cities in the country. |
